            • I don't know what to think of this.

              3yrs $12M seems like a good price for Jackson. Teams have learned, and the market was predictably soft for an over 30yr old RB. He gained over 1K yards rushing last year, but has over 10K for his career...30+ and 10K yards, not a good combination.

              Still, I can't help but think it would have been worth a chance. $4million guaranteed? Sounds like it could essentially be a 1yr $4million contract, and I think that would have been worth the chance that he had another year left in him. If TT didn't want to pay that, I wonder what 'their price' was?
